"Another Wasted Life.”
That’s the name of a remarkable new song by the Pulitzer Prize-winning, Grammy-winning artist
Rhiannon Giddens.
She released a video of the song on October 2 to mark International Wrongful Conviction Day.
The song was inspired by
Kalief Browder,
a Bronx resident who died by suicide in 2015 at the age of 22
after being detained at Rikers Island jail for nearly three years,
